BẠN ĐÃ NGHE VỀ BITCOIN VÀ MUỐN TÌM HIỂU CHÍNH THỐNG?

HƯỚNG DẪN TOÀN TẬP ĐẦU TƯ VỚI THỊ TRƯỜNG BITCOIN 2021

>> Xem tại đây <<

học laravel 5

Bài 2 : Cài đặt Laravel Framework 5

bài trước, chúng ta cũng đã phần nào hiểu được Laravel 5 và những tính năng cơ bản của Laravel 5 rồi phải không nào ? Ắt hẳn các bạn sẽ có rất nhiều thắc mắc, có những phần chưa hiểu, đừng lo lắng, hãy cứ học 1 cách từ từ “chậm mà chắc” như ông bà ta thường nói. Trong bài hôm nay, blog sẽ gửi tới các bạn hướng dẫn cài đặt laravel 5 trên window và ubuntu 14.04.

Lưu ý : Máy của bạn nhớ kết nối internet trong suốt quá trình cài đặt nhé

>>Cập nhật : Xem Hướng dẫn cài đặt Laravel phiên bản 5.4 mới nhất tại đây <<

1. Cài đặt Laravel 5 trên window

A. Chuẩn bị

a. Để cài đặt Laravel 5, ít nhất trên máy bạn phải có phiên bản PHP >=5.3.7 và Mcrypt PHP Extension. Nếu các bạn đã cài Xampp hoặc Wamp thì đã bao gồm 2 điều kiện trên và không cần phải cài đặt lại.

b. Bật extension php_openssl (mở file php.ini lên rồi tìm dòng ;extension=php_openssl.dll, bỏ dấu ; ở đầu dòng đi, save file lại rồi restart apache)

c. Download và cài đặt Composer cho window tại link getcomposer.org/Composer-Setup.exe . Trong quá trình cài đặt composer, một thông báo sẽ hiện lên hỏi bạn chọn thư mục chứa file php.exe. Đối với wamp, nó sẽ nằm ở đường dẫn giống thế này C:\wamp\bin\php\php5.5.12\php.exe hoặc đối với xampp thì là thế này c:\xampp\php\php.exe

d. Download và cài đặt Git phiên bản window tại msysgit.googlecode.com/files/Git-1.8.3-preview20130601.exe

Gợi ý xem : Tặng coupon giảm giá 40% khóa học Laravel

B. Bắt đầu cài đặt Laravel 5

Bước 1 : Ấn phím Window, trong box Search programs and files, gõ cmd rồi enter

Bước 2 : Trong cmd, gõ lệnh sau để di chuyển ra ổ C

cd C://

Tiếp đến gõ lệnh sau để di chuyển vào thư mục gốc của website (www đối với Wamp)

cd C:\wamp\www

Bước 3 : Chạy lệnh dưới đây để tạo ra project laravel

composer create-project laravel/laravel ten-project-cua-ban --prefer-dist

với ten-project-cua-ban là tên thư mục chứa project laravel và bạn có thể đặt tên tùy thích (ở đây mình đặt tên là laravel-5), sau khi chạy lệnh trên chờ một thời gian sau khi tiến trình chạy xong, bạn sẽ thấy thư mục chứa project laravel 5.

cấu trúc thư mục laravel 5

Bước 3 : Vào trình duyệt gõ đường dẫn http://localhost/laravel-5/public, nếu bạn thấy hiện ra như dưới đây là bạn đã cài đặt thành công

Gợi ý : Bạn là người mới và muốn tìm hiểu về Bitcoin nhưng không biết bắt đầu từ đâu? Click xem ngay Hướng Dẫn Đầu Tư Bitcoin Cho Người Mới nhé!

cài đặt laravel 5

 2. Cài đặt Laravel 5 trên Ubuntu 14.04

A. Chuẩn bị

Trước tiên khi cài đặt Laravel, bạn cần phải đảm bảo rằng Apache, PHP, MySQL trên ubuntu đã được cài đặt. Tiếp đó bạn cần cài đặt Mcrypt PHP Extension.

sudo apt-get install php5-mcrypt

sau đó restart lại apache bằng 2 lệnh dưới đây

sudo php5enmod mcrypt
sudo service apache2 restart

a. Cài đặt Composer trên ubuntu

Mở Terminal (Ctrl + Alt +T), gõ dòng lệnh sau để cài đặt Composer

curl -sS https://getcomposer.org/installer | php

Di chuyển Composer đến thư mục /usr/local/bin/composer

mv composer.phar /usr/local/bin/composer

b. Bật chế độ rewrite trong Apache

sudo a2enmod rewrite

B. Tiến hành cài đặt

Bước 1 : Chạy lệnh composer

Mở terminal, di chuyển đến thư mục gốc

cd /var/www/html

rồi chạy tiếp lệnh sau để cài đặt

composer create-project laravel/laravel ten-project-cua-ban --prefer-dist

với ten-project-cua-ban là tên thư mục chứa project bạn có thể đặt tùy thích, sau khi chạy lệnh trên chờ một thời gian sau khi tiến trình chạy xong, bạn sẽ thấy thư mục chứa project laravel của bạn.

cấu trúc thư mục laravel 5

Bước 2 : Thiết lập quyền cho thư mục storage

Từ đường dẫn hiện hành (/var/www/html/laravel), gõ lệnh sau để thiết lập quyền 777 cho thư mục storage

chmod -R 777 app/storage/

Bước 3 : Sau khi cài đặt xong các bước trên, bạn chạy tiếp lệnh sau :

php artisan serve

thấy hình Laravel 5 như dưới đây hiện ra là bạn đã cài đặt thành công

cài đặt laravel 5

 

Xem thêm : Khóa học tạo website hoàn chỉnh với Laravel 5 tặng mã giảm giá 40% + Hỗ trợ việc làm sau khi học xong

Tổng kết : Như vậy các bạn đã biết cách cài đặt Laravel 5 trên Window và Ubuntu, bài viết theo mình sẽ hướng dẫn các bạn về khái niệm Routes, Controller, View trong Laravel 5, chúc các bạn học tốt !

Bài tiếp theo : Routes, Controller, View trong Laravel 5

Có ích

học laravel 5

Bài 6 : Migrations trong Laravel 5

Trong bài viết này mình sẽ giới thiệu đến các bạn về migrations trong Laravel …

Subscribe
Notify of
guest
33 Bình Luận
Inline Feedbacks
Xem Tất Cả Bình Luận
Bình
Bình
3 năm trước

Mình đang gặp vến đề với Laravel 5 như sau:
mình tạo Route:
Route::get(‘hello’, function() {
return “Chào các bạn đã đế với khóa học Laravel 5!”;
});
Chạy trên trình duyệt http://localhost/thumucgoc/hello báo lỗi: 404 Not found “The webpage cannot be found”.
Nhưng khi chạy: http://localhost/thumucgoc/index.php/hello thì không có lỗi gì
kết quả cho dòng: Chào các bạn đã đế với khóa học Laravel 5!
Bạn chỉ mình cách bỏ index.php đi được không?
Chân thành cảm ơn!

abc
abc
5 năm trước

minhf cung bi loi “Warning: Module ‘openssl’ already loaded in Unknown on line 0” .Moi nguoi giup minh voi a

Lưu Thân
Phản hồi đến  abc
4 năm trước

Lỗi “Warning: Module ‘openssl’ already loaded in Unknown on line 0” là khi bạn cài bản xampp hiện tại đã bật tính năng này rồi, bạn bật lại sẽ lỗi, bạn tìm theo php_openssl sẽ hiện ra

votanhieu
votanhieu
5 năm trước

mấy bạn ơi cho hình hỏi có mấy tài liệu giới thiệu có cài homestead hay virtual box nữa mình ko hiểu nó có cần thiết ko tại mình thấy đây ko có ạ

Nguyen Duc Van
Nguyen Duc Van
5 năm trước

Xin chào! Khi mình cài Composer thì nó có dòng cảnh báo “Warning: Module ‘openssl’ already loaded in Unknown on line 0” và mình dùng xampp! ai giúp mình fix với liên lạc qua email hoặc facebook:https://www.facebook.com/nguyenducvanhust
Mình xin cảm ơn!

Kieu_anh
Kieu_anh
5 năm trước

Ad ơi, ad cho em hỏi, em chỉ tìm thấy file php.ini-development thôi ạ, em có thấy dòng ;extension=php_opensll.dll ạ.Có phải file đó không ạ? Em tìm mà không được ạ.Em cảm ơn ad ạ.

Phong Nguyễn
Phong Nguyễn
5 năm trước

Warning: require(C:\xampp\htdocs\MoneyOld_Laravel\bootstrap/../vendor/autoload.php): failed to open stream: No such file or directory in C:\xampp\htdocs\MoneyOld_Laravel\bootstrap\autoload.php on line 17
cài xong nó báo lỗi thế nào là s add?

QuangLee
QuangLee
Phản hồi đến  Phong Nguyễn
5 năm trước

mình cũng đang bị lỗi này, bạn đã fix được chưa. Bảo mình với

Nguyễn Thanh Việt
Nguyễn Thanh Việt
5 năm trước

–> Bật extension php_openssl (mở file php.ini lên rồi tìm dòng ;extension=php_openssl.dll, bỏ dấu ; ở đầu dòng đi, save file lại rồi restart apache)
Cho hỏi file php_openssl và php.ini ở đâu vậy ạ?

Tuấn Ngọc
Tuấn Ngọc
5 năm trước

Thực hành trên Ubuntu mình k sử dụng ubuntu. Có trên windown k cho xin tài liệu học với Thanks.

NhiBC
NhiBC
5 năm trước

bạn ơi cho mình hỏi có cách nào đổi tên web của mình không. Ví dụ tên project đặt là mypageview, nhưng khi chạy thì là library… ??

smagic39
5 năm trước

mà tại sao lại có “thich nhat hanh” trong màn hình chào của laravel nhỉ

Trí Minh
Trí Minh
6 năm trước

mình gọi localhost/demo-laravel-5/public thì nó không chạy nhưng khi mình vào cmd gõ lệnh php artisan serve rồi chạy localhost:8000 thì thấy đã chạy đúng. nhưng mình không cách nào vào được localhost/demo-laravel-5/public. vậy project mình tạo là đúng hay sai, và làm sao để mình gọi được localhost/demo-laravel-5/public

MInh Tri
6 năm trước

mình dùng xampp không gọi localhost/demo-laravel-5/public được nhưng vào cmd gõ lệnh php artisan serve thì khi chạy localhost:8000 lại chạy được, nhưng mình vẫn không truy cập được vào localhost/demo-laravel-5/public, sửa thành localhost:8000/demo-laravel-5/public thì báo lỗi Sorry, the page you are looking for could not be found. giúp mình với

MInh Tri
6 năm trước

mình đặt tên project là demo-laravel-5 nhưng sau khi cài đặt xong gõ đường dẫn http://localhost/demo-laravel-5/public thì không chạy. nhưng mình vào cmd gõ php artisan server thi có thông báo vào đường link htpp://localhost:8000/, vào thì thấy chạy đúng, vậy có cách nào để mình có thể gọi trực tiếp trên browser mà không cần vào cmd gõ lệnh không

Trí Minh
Trí Minh
Phản hồi đến  MInh Tri
6 năm trước

sorry vì đã spam câu hỏi, tại page không cập nhật liền nên mình nghĩ là bị lỗi. ai biết giúp mình vấn đề nào với

Nguyễn Phương
6 năm trước

cho mình hỏi, mình bắt đàu tìm hiểu về laravel, mà khi cài phiên bản nó là 5.1, có cách nào cài đúng phiên bản 5.0 ko ad nhỉ, để mình dễ làm theo hướng dẫn, vì 5.1 nó khác kha khá

ChungTranIT
ChungTranIT
Phản hồi đến  Nguyễn Phương
6 năm trước

composer create-project laravel/laravel {directory} 5.0 –prefer-dist

Đỗ Văn Nhất
Đỗ Văn Nhất
6 năm trước

mình đã làm theo bạn nhưng đến bước gõ trong cmd.gõ xong ->enter thì lại không có hiện tượng gì
Bạn có thể giúp mình đc ko

Yến
Yến
6 năm trước

Làm sao để tắt composer trên cmd vậy bạn?

teoem
teoem
Phản hồi đến  Yến
6 năm trước

composer chi la 1 phan mem, cmd va composer ko co lien quan gi nha ban. De xoa composer, ban chi viec lam theo sau day :
Click nut Start button , tim Controler Panel, click Control Panel, click Programs, click Programs and Features.
Sau do chon chuong trinh composer ban da cai roi click click Uninstall. Cach xoa composer y nhu xoa 1 chuong trinh binh thuong ah`. Neu ban khong xoa duoc nhu tren,thi co the la do may tinh cua ban bi loi~ gi do.

Tuấn
Tuấn
6 năm trước

mình cái cái composer nó báo lỗi ” The phar extension is missing. Install it or recompile php without –disable-phar” làm sao sửa đc vậy mọi người

Yến
Yến
6 năm trước

có cách nào gỡ composer không bạn. Mình gỡ nó cứ báo lỗi đang mở

Yến
Yến
Phản hồi đến  Tôi Là Hoàng Hiếu
6 năm trước

Mình restart không được. Hình như máy mình khởi động là cmd cũng khởi động. Làm thế nào để tắt vậy bạn?

titi
titi
6 năm trước

Minh tim kiem cach cai dat tren mang nhung thay kho hieu qua,minh da lam theo bai viet cua ban va cai dat thanh cong, yeh, cam on admin,

Thái
Phản hồi đến  Tôi Là Hoàng Hiếu
5 năm trước

cho mình hỏi ở bước chmod -R 777 app/storage/ nó báo là chmod: cannot access ‘app/storage’: No such file or directory
mong bạn trả lời sớm

Sang
Sang
Phản hồi đến  Thái
5 năm trước

Nó báo vậy tức là thư mục app/storage ko tồn tại bạn nhé.

33
0
Bạn có ý kiến về bài viết, hãy để lại bình luận nhé!x
()
x